Reflections on 'The Magic Mountain'
In this chapter, the speakers share their personal connections to Thomas Mann's 'The Magic Mountain,' discussing its impact on their lives and academic journeys. They explore the profound themes of existential dread, societal shifts, and the complexities of human interaction present in the novel. The dialogue raises questions about the current literary landscape and the shifting significance of classic works in contemporary culture.
